Compliance: CMS To Stop Overcharging For Overpayments

Find out which hidden costs you'll no longer need to worry about.Starting this fall, there'll be a little less tit for tat from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services - and a little more money in your pocketbook, according to a final rule published in the July 30 Federal Register.      The agency says the way it calculates and charges interest on Medicare overpayments and underpayments to providers, suppliers, health maintenance organizations, Medicare secondary payers and other entities will now "better reflect current business practices."      Under current rules...
